Output 140184fc13a59c67492243541a715225391b8e29cabdd616642b525fa5f2969a:27

value
25622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b755f1f3c8a4e17217ca178077153397247ee07 OP_EQUAL
address
34CCmqqcbgXAr49ZGeLbohBnrUmdnSYuVC
transaction
140184fc13a59c67492243541a715225391b8e29cabdd616642b525fa5f2969a
spent
true